LED Color Lighting

Color LEDs designed for illumination purposes exhibit specific characteristics such as a fixed wavelength or wavelength range, color group, and viewing angles ranging from 60 to 170 degrees. These LEDs are available in a variety of surface mount packages, including SMD, CSDM, PLCC, J-lead, gull wing, exposed pad, and an extensive selection of metric sizes. Additionally, through-hole package options like TO-252, DPak, SC-63, and radial lead configurations are also available. The diverse package types and configurations cater to different application requirements and assembly methods. Surface mount packages provide compact and efficient options for automated assembly processes, while through-hole configurations offer stability and reliability for manual soldering. Color LEDs used for illumination purposes find applications in various industries, such as architectural lighting, automotive lighting, signage, and backlighting. Their precise control over wavelength and color allows for customization and flexibility in achieving the desired lighting effects. The wide range of package options ensures compatibility with different design constraints and facilitates seamless integration into lighting fixtures and systems. In summary, color LEDs used for illumination exhibit specific wavelength characteristics, color groups, and viewing angles. They are available in a diverse range of surface mount and through-hole packages, enabling versatile application possibilities and accommodating various assembly methods. These LEDs play a crucial role in delivering efficient and customizable lighting solutions across multiple industries.
